Praise by Music

Well, I may as well be upfront. I am in love: with St. Martin’s Church and School; with my wife; and with the birthday present my wife gave me this year. I have a brand new guitar! Most of you probably don’t know that I have played (modestly) off and on since I was eight, mainly folky stuff and influenced by Joan Baez, Bob Dylan, Paul Simon, the Kingston Trio, and many others. My father taught me the basics and they gave me the guitars I still own. This new one is something I have always wanted – not a replacement but a different type, and thanks to the generosity of my beloved it is now mine.

I ran across a verse in Isaiah: The LORD will save me, and we will sing with stringed instruments all the days of our lives in the temple of the LORD (Isaiah 38:20). Great quote, isn’t it. For me it has special significance because it brings together the greatest joys of my life in one placed, The Lord’s House, singing and guitars – well yes I know they didn’t have guitars per se in those days, but the would have if they could have!

This is the month of Thanksgiving for our nation. Despite hard times we have much to be grateful for. And thanksgivings are one of the primary types of prayer we are commended to make. If we would thank God more I suspect we would find ourselves less burdened. Still, the greatest form of prayer isn’t thanksgiving, nor petition (for ourselves), nor intercessions (for others), as important as they all are. The ultimate calling we have from God is praise. Praise if joy; praise is being overwhelmed in love; praise is the state we will be in heaven to come. I truly believe we will be there with guitars as well as our voices.
